Ranking of Montana Cities and Places By Percentage of American Indian and Alaska Native Alone Households with Household Income of $50K - $59K in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on November 20, 2023.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the percentage of American Indian and Alaska Native Alone households in Montana with household income of $50k - $59k was 7.78%. Among all Montana cities and places with a population of at least 10K, Bozeman city had the highest percentage of American Indian and Alaska Native Alone households with household income of $50k - $59k (41.43%), followed by Helena city (39.42%), and Missoula city (18.84%).

On the other hand, the following 3 cities had low percentages of American Indian and Alaska Native Alone households with household income of $50k - $59k: Belgrade city (0.00%), Butte-Silver Bow (balance) (0.00%), and Great Falls city (0.00%).
